The plan involves engaging landowners and friends to identify suitable sites for planting. The narrator calls their friend Heath, owner of a paddock with steep terrain unsuitable for agriculture, who estimates capacity for thousands of new trees. They also reach out to others—friends, family, and farmers—to gather commitments for planting trees on various properties. A tally begins to take shape, with initial estimates around 3,400 trees allocated across multiple land parcels.
